Hiyun Population - Mandi, Himachal Pradesh

Hiyun is a small village located in Padhar Tehsil of Mandi district, Himachal Pradesh with total 20 families residing. The Hiyun village has population of 80 of which 39 are males while 41 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Hiyun village population of children with age 0-6 is 12 which makes up 15.00 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Hiyun village is 1051 which is higher than Himachal Pradesh state average of 972. Child Sex Ratio for the Hiyun as per census is 714, lower than Himachal Pradesh average of 909.

Hiyun village has lower literacy rate compared to Himachal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Hiyun village was 80.88 % compared to 82.80 % of Himachal Pradesh. In Hiyun Male literacy stands at 90.63 % while female literacy rate was 72.22 %.
